The UAE’s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ation (MOHRE) has listed multiple scenarios under which visa violators can regularize their status. This is part of the UAE government’s two-month amnesty period that came into effect on September 1.

MOHRE has listed the following scenarios as well as procedures that need to be followed depending on whether the individual intends to stay inside the country or leave.

  • Category 1: This refers to residency violators whose residency has expired and who do not hold a valid work permit issued by MOHRE.
  • Category 2: This refers to residency violators whose residency has expired and who hold an expired work permit issued by MOHRE under the establishments or domestic workers category
  • Category 3: This refers to residency violators whose residency has expired and who hold a valid work permit issued by MOHRE under the establishments or domestic workers category, with a pending complaint of work abandonment filed against them.
  • Category 4: This refers to visit visa violators who have overstayed the duration specified by their visit visa.

Procedures to follow

For the first category of individuals, if the violating resident wishes to work for a new employer, then the new employer must apply for a new work permit through the ministry or the relevant authority, depending on the establishment’s affiliation.

However, if the violating resident wishes to remain with their current employer, the current employer must apply for residency renewal through one of the channels of the Federal Authority for Identity, Citizenship, Customs, and Port Security.

If the violating resident wishes to leave the country, he must apply for an exit permit through the authority’s systems.

For the second category of individuals, if the violating worker wishes to remain with their current employer, the current employer must apply for a work permit renewal through MOHRE’s channels, in accordance with the procedures to maintain the contractual relationship.

But, if the current employer wishes to change the violating worker’s status by either cancelling the permit or reporting work abandonment, the current employer must apply for work permit cancellation through the MOHRE’s channels, or they must submit a complaint for work abandonment.

Moreover, if the violating worker wishes to join a new employer, then the new employer must apply for a work permit issuance.

For the third category of individuals, the MOHRE has listed the following steps: If the current employer wants to reinstate and continue the contractual relationship, and if the violating worker’s permit has expired, then the current employer must apply for a work permit renewal without canceling the work abandonment complaint.

If the violating worker’s permit is still valid, then the current employer must apply to cancel the work abandonment complaint.

However, if the violating worker wishes to join a new employer, then the new employer must apply for a new work permit.

For the fourth category, if the violating visitor wishes to work for a new employer then the new employer must apply for a new work permit through MOHRE’s channels. If the violating visitor wishes to leave the country, he must apply for an exit permit.
